The Comprehensive Guide to Entry Door Restoration: Reviving Your Home’s First Impressions

Entry doors play an essential role in the looks and security of a home. They are not simply a barrier against the aspects or a point of entry; they are the centerpiece of your home’s exterior, frequently setting the tone for visitors. Gradually, nevertheless, wear and tear, weather, and other aspects can decrease the appeal and performance of an entry door. Thankfully, entry door restoration is an effective service that can extend the life of this crucial element of your home while improving its visual appeal.

Comprehending Entry Door Restoration

Entry door restoration includes various processes that intend to repair, refinish, and rejuvenate a door. While it might sound like a difficult task, bring back an entry door can be a gratifying home improvement job for property owners who are keen on keeping their residence’s appeal and stability.

Benefits of Entry Door Restoration

  1. Cost-Effectiveness: Restoring a door is typically significantly more economical than replacing it. Numerous house owners can conserve a considerable quantity by buying restoration instead of brand-new doors.

  2. Enhanced Curb Appeal: A brought back entry door can considerably improve the exterior look of a home, resulting in an increased property worth and enhanced impressions.

  3. Eco-Friendly: Restoration assists in minimizing waste. Rather of discarding a functional door, restoration adds to a more sustainable approach by prolonging its lifespan.

  4. Increased Security: Often, older doors might have become weak or jeopardized. Restoration can enhance the door’s strength, enhancing the security of the home.

  5. Customization: Restoration permits property owners to personalize their entry door, from color to finish, aligning it more carefully with their individual taste or architectural design.

The Restoration Process: Step by Step

The restoration of an entry door typically includes numerous key actions. These can differ based upon the door’s condition and material, however the procedure normally includes:

1. Assessment and Preparation

  • Removal: Take off any hardware such as doorknobs, hinges, or locks.

2. Cleaning up

  • Use a mix of soap and water to clean up the door thoroughly.
  • For wooden doors, consider utilizing a wood cleaner to eliminate old surfaces.

3. Fixing Damages

  • Wood Doors: Fill in fractures and holes with wood filler and sand the location smooth.
  • Metal Doors: For rusted metal doors, sanding or using a rust-inhibiting guide might be required.

4. Sanding

  • Sand the whole door to produce a smooth surface for refinishing.
  • Use fine-grit sandpaper for finishing touches.

5. Refinishing

  • *Staining: For wooden doors, use stain to enhance the natural grain.
  • *Painting: For both wood and metal doors, use a premium exterior paint or finish.

6. Reinstallation of Hardware

  • After the paint has actually dried, thoroughly reattach the doorknobs, locks, and hinges.

7. Sealing

  • Apply a sealant for wooden doors to secure from moisture and UV rays. Metal doors might need a rustproof sealant.

Tips for Successful Entry Door Restoration

  • Select Quality Materials: Whether it’s spots, paints, or sealants, picking top quality products can offer much better outcomes and extend the life-span of the restoration.

  • Operate In Appropriate Conditions: Ensure you’re operating in conditions that are not too damp, rainy, or cold to allow appropriate adhesion and drying.

  • Keep Regular Care: After restoration, regular maintenance such as cleaning and resealing can lengthen the durability of the door.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How often should an entry door be restored?

A: The frequency of restoration depends on direct exposure to components, door material, and maintenance. Generally, wooden doors may need restoration every 5-10 years, while metal doors can last longer if maintained correctly.

Q2: Can I restore a door myself, or should I hire a professional?

A: Many property owners can successfully restore a door themselves if they have basic DIY skills. Nevertheless, for extensive repairs or if you’re unpredictable, employing a professional is a good idea.

Q3: What are the signs that my door requires restoration?

A: Common indications include peeling paint, fractures, considerable wear or water damage, or problem in opening and closing the door.

Q4: Is it worth bring back a door that is very old?

A: If the door is structurally sound, restoration can be an exceptional alternative. Nevertheless, if the door shows considerable damages or rot, replacement may be preferable.

Q5: How can I ensure the finish of my brought back door lasts?

A: Regular maintenance such as cleansing, resealing, and repainting when essential will assist lengthen the life expectancy of the finish.
